Summary

With his fiery, inspirational speeches, tireless championing of workers, and strong support for grassroots organizations, Robert "Fighting Bob" La Follette is an almost mythical figure in politics, the type of idealized leader that unfortunately appears more often in fiction than in real government. As a U.S. representative, governor, and U.S. senator, La Follette left enduring political legacies: direct election of senators, child labor laws, environmental protections, women's suffrage, and workers' compensation. La Follette led the opposition to American entry into World War I and made a remarkable third-party bid for the presidency in 1924. Under his leadership, Wisconsin was the first state in the nation to enact many reforms, cementing a lasting reputation for progressive leanings among its citizens and government. But Fighting Bob's righteous fervor was not without consequence, and he suffered financially, physically, and emotionally from the enormous pressure he exerted on himself.
